Default 01 blazer zr2, wheel size

looking to get some 31x10.5x15 BFG A/T tires and am wondering what size wheel i should go with (backspacing) so that i can avoid the 2 front tires from sticking too far out from the fender. with 15x8 soft 8's with 4 inch back spacing, the tires in front stick out about 1 1/2 inches from the fender and the rear tires are nice and flush with the fender. does anyone know a combination that will eliminate that stupid dune buggy look with the front tires??

I believe its 6 inches of backspacing... so your 4inch backspacing is leaving about the 2 inch gap that you are seeing...
